Jeffrey B. Loeb joins Rich May
Rich May is pleased to announce that Jeffrey B. Loeb has joined the firm’s Litigation Department as Counsel. Jeff has more than 15 years of experience representing clients in litigation and a broad array of other matters. Jeff is a graduate of Yale University (B.A. 1982) and Boston College Law School (J.D. 1985, cum laude).
